Dear New Girl,
My name is Jessamine, but most people called me Jessie. Yes, I did just write 'called.' I'm dead. I'm a ghost and I live here with you. I know a ghost isn't an ideal roommate, but I promise that I never leave my clothes or food wrappers lying around. I'm sure we'll get along just fine. 
I was born in the hospital just down the road from here. Sadly, my mother passed away while giving birth to me so I never got to meet her. Sometimes I wonder if the saying really is true. "It is better to have loved and lost than to never have loved at all." My father raised me in this house. I grew up in this bedroom, playing dolls, having sleepovers with friends, dancing to my vinyl. Do you know what that is? Does anyone use vinyl anymore? I took my first steps in the hallway connecting this room to the others in the house. I had my first birthday party in the kitchen downstairs. Please paint over that horrendous blue wall. My father never would. This house means a lot to me so please take care of it. 
I have to tell you how I died in order to move on and into the proper afterlife. It isn't a pretty story so I understand if you don't want to hear it. Clara, the last girl that lived here didn't. That's my warning for you, New Girl.
Please write back,
J
